M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 –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.
Learn more about the authoritative new book MOOCs and Open Education
M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
studies
issues
having to do with open
education resources
and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
The latest
developments in
blended learning technology make it possible for
learners
in nations all around the world
to take online courses.
Massively open online courses are
generally free
for learners but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
